1,引入了JAVA泛型類,因此定義了一個Object[] 類型的數組,從而可以保存各種不同類型的對象。 2,默認構造方法創建了一個默認大小為16的Object數組;帶參數的構造方法創建一個指定長度的Object數組 3,實現的順序表的基本操作有:返回表的長度、獲取指定索引處的元素(注意是索引 ...
. 順序存儲結構:把數據元素放在 地址連續的存儲單元里 定義一個結構放順序存儲的內容 . 順序表的操作 . 建空表, . 插入元素, .刪除元素, . 按位置查找元素, . 按照元素查找位置, . 去除表中重復元素, . 求表長度 表中實際元素個數 , . 修改表中元素值,合並 個順序表, . 銷毀順序表 . 源碼:一級指針建表方式實現 seqlist.c文件 seqlist.h文件: 測試ma ...
2019-05-19 21:53 0 487 推薦指數:
1,引入了JAVA泛型類,因此定義了一個Object[] 類型的數組,從而可以保存各種不同類型的對象。 2,默認構造方法創建了一個默認大小為16的Object數組;帶參數的構造方法創建一個指定長度的Object數組 3,實現的順序表的基本操作有:返回表的長度、獲取指定索引處的元素(注意是索引 ...
C++ 中常用的一些東西,通過使用動態數組來實現順序表, 掌握了一下知識點: 1.預處理有三中方法 宏定義,文件包含,條件編譯 2.使用同名的變量時,可以在外層使用命名空間 類解決變量名重定義的錯誤 3.類中三個訪問權限, public : 公有訪問權限,主要寫一些函數接口 ...
線性表的順序存儲結構,指的是用一段連續的存儲單元依次存儲線性表的數據元素。 因為是連續的存儲單元,so,,可以使用一維數組來實現它的順序存儲結構。 ...
...
一、分析 什么是順序表?順序表是指用一組地址連續的存儲單元依次存儲各個元素,使得在邏輯結構上相鄰的數據元素存儲在相鄰的物理存儲單元中的線性表。一個標准的順序表需要實現以下基本操作: 1、初始化順序表 2、銷毀順序表 3、清空順序表 4、檢測順序表是否為空 ...
python實現順序表可以有兩中形式進行存儲 列表 元組 其實簡單來說,順序表無非就是操作列表和元組的方法來對順序表進行操作。 實例代碼 運行結果 1 2 192345 12345 ...
現在常用的數據結構分為線性結構和非線性結構,而線性結構包括表,棧,隊列,非線性包括樹,圖等等。按照數據存儲方式有可以將表分為順序表和鏈表,棧分為順序棧,鏈棧,隊列也可以有鏈是隊列。在高級語言中通常用數組來表示順序存儲結構,所以表,棧,隊列都可以用數組來做。 ...
實現任意數據類型的順序表的初始化,插入,刪除(按值刪除;按位置刪除),銷毀功能。、 順序表結構體 實現順序表結構體的三個要素:(1)數組首地址;(2)數組的大小;(3)當前數組元素的個數。 注意事項:void **addr為二級指針,即數組的元素也為指針 ...